E495 JLC is a 1988 Daimler Limousine Auto in Cream with a 4,235c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 22 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 86.4%.

Across all 1988 Daimler Limousine Auto models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.7% with a typical mileage of 86,089 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Daimler Limousine Auto f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 504 recorded failures. If you're considering buying E495 JLC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Daimler Limousine Auto typically stays on UK roads for around 55 years. At 38 years old, this Daimler Limousine Auto is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
